I think if you're not dedicating enough time to a proper Universal parks trip it wouldn't be worth it, especially July this year. Why? Parks will likely be busier than normal with the new HP coaster opening (if you're not planning on getting express pass this would probably kill your enthusiasm for Uni altogether).

Secondly, I think 1 day is just simply not enough time to see and explore WWoHP at both parks, especially if your kids are into HP! Our recent 4 day trip was spent at least 50% of the time in those park areas, and that's probably because we left and enjoyed other parts when HP got really busy. So, if you're plan is to ONLY see HP worlds I suppose with a park-to-park it is possible but then you'd miss out on the rest of the parks. Again, keeping in mind July will be a busy time of the year. I'd hate to plan only one day and miss out on parts of HP let alone other parts of both parks.

I would also check height requirements for the rides as has been mentioned. This would have been a deal breaker for our last trip (luckily my 7yr old is a big kid and could ride everything except Hulk). If he was too short for Forbidden Journey (the Hogwarts ride in Hosmeade/IoA) that would have made me postpone (or maybe do Disney).

If your kids are definitely into HP it's worth it to spend a few days dedicated to Uni. You can stay there, benefit from the resort ammenities/bonuses, get discounts on longer stays, and explore all the nooks of these great parks as well!
